Elite Technical is seeking a Quality Engineer, who will be required to review engineering drawings, customer procurement specifications, material and material testing specifications, or other contractual requirements to develop program quality plans, inspection procedures, or shop floor work instructions to support program success. The individual will also prepare Manufacturing and Inspection Procedures (MIP) and Objective Quality Evidence (OQE) packages that will include raw material certifications, material testing reports, inspection reports, or other objective evidence of product conformance. The individual will monitor manufacturing processes and support in-process and final acceptance / rejection of SCI products. Position will dually report to the Quality Department Manager and Project Tech Lead as assigned. This position requires use of information which is sub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) and candidate must be able to obtain and maintain a DoD security clearance.


Job Requirements:

- Interface closely with engineering to review customer requirements to develop requirements matrix and project Quality Plans.

- Develop inspection plans and procedures as required based on customer specifications.

- Develop / review manufacturing work instructions for adequacy prior to release.

- Prepare Objective Quality Evidence (OQE) documentation/packages.

- Evaluate quality control processes and protocols recommending new or improved processes as necessary.

- Lead root cause, corrective and preventive action investigations and follow up as required.

- Conduct/coordinate process and product evaluations and assessments on the manufacturing floor and in a laboratory environment.

- Conduct internal audits on SCI-s Quality Management System for effectiveness as scheduled.

- Collaborate with various functions to assure compliance and continuous improvement.

- Conduct internal audits on production processes to evaluate product conformance to customer requirements

- Assist with the development and improvement of the Quality Management System.

Required Skills


- 3-8 years experience Bachelors Degree in Composite, Mechanical, Industrial or related engineering degree is required.

- Must have the ability to obtain and maintain a US DoD security clearance.

- Background in performing assessments and audits on equipment, processes and procedures to ensure compliance to specifications, engineering drawings, procedures and ISO-9000 requirements.

- Proficient with reading and interpreting engineering drawings, customer specifications, and material requirements.

- Effective communication and interpersonal skills required to interface with functional team members, executive management and customer representatives.

- Demonstrated experience in Quality Engineering and Quality Management Systems.

- Proficient utilizing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ook)

- Utilize various inspection methods, tools and equipment to accomplish necessary product examinations to include, but not limited to, calibrated equipment, special tooling, part inspections, etc.

- This position requires use of information which is subject to the International Traffic in Arms

- Familiarity or experience with SolidWorks model and drawing development is a plus

- Perform materials testing processes per written procedures (e.g. Microscopy, Short Beam Shear, Burnouts, etc. if necessary)

- Implement quality controls and protocols across several program platforms.

- First article inspection experience desired.

- Ability to ascend and descend vertical work ladders, work in confined spaces and lift loads of approximately 50 pounds.

- Ability to bend, stoop or climb as necessary to perform required inspections.

- Work in this occupation involves using your hands to hold, control, and feel objects.
